Description

In a forgotten corner of Arizona, the Saguaro Riptide Motel stands as a testament to faded glories and hidden secrets. The surf-themed establishment attracts a mix of weary travelers and locals, all seeking refuge from the mundane. Its peeling paint and quirky decor might disguise its true nature, but beneath the surface lies an undercurrent of intrigue and danger.

As the sun sets over the Sonoran Desert, the motel's barren walls whisper tales of discontent and desperation. Guests come and go, each with their own story, but few are what they seem. Tensions rise as a series of unsettling events unfold, drawing the attention of the locals and igniting curiosity among the guests.

With paranoia lurking like the shadows cast by the saguaros outside, the inhabitants find themselves entangled in a web of deception and madness. The Riptide, once a mere stopover, transforms into a haunting ground where every choice can plunge them deeper into chaos. In this strange place, not all waves are meant to be ridden, and every tide carries with it a potential reckoning.
